## Onboarding: ChipGate Reader Service

Reviewers: the ChipGate service ingests timing-chip reads from mats along the Oakhollow Marathon course. Watch for duplicate-read suppression in pull requests — it's our most common regression. Local testing uses the replay harness with canned chip data. To decrypt the sample dataset on first setup, use the recovery passphrase given below.

unlock words, hahip-baduf: holwyn-istath-julvan

## Document Transport — Uniforms for the Fenhollow Depot

Couriers serving the new Fenhollow depot wear grey Brastin Logistics jackets with a green collar tab, replacing the older blue fleet uniform. Receiving staff should not accept parcels from anyone in the outdated blue kit after the first of the month. The confidential hand-over instruction for couriers is recorded below.

courier memo of fahag-badug: the norys istion courier leaves the zoriel ledger at gate 4000 under passcode 457370

TURN-208: Gatevale turnstile counters at the Merrow Field pilot double-count when a rotation reverses mid-cycle. Attendance totals drift roughly 2% high per event. The debounce window fix is implemented, reviewed by Ilsa, and soak-tested across two simulated match days without drift. Ready for your cut; the candidate build is identified below.

trace token, tagag-tafog: htk6_5ed18c